คำถามติดแท็ก textkit

16
วิธีฝังไอคอนขนาดเล็กใน UILabel
ฉันต้องฝังไอคอนเล็ก ๆ (เรียงลำดับของกระสุนที่กำหนดเอง) ลงUILabelใน iOS7 ฉันจะทำสิ่งนี้ในผู้ออกแบบอินเตอร์เฟสได้อย่างไร หรืออย่างน้อยในรหัส? ใน Android มีleftDrawableและrightDrawableสำหรับป้ายกำกับ แต่ทำใน iOS ได้อย่างไร ตัวอย่างใน Android:

11
การตรวจจับการแตะที่ข้อความที่ระบุใน UITextView ใน iOS
ฉันมีUITextViewที่แสดงNSAttributedStringไฟล์. สตริงนี้มีคำที่ฉันต้องการทำให้แตะได้ดังนั้นเมื่อมีการแตะฉันจะถูกเรียกกลับเพื่อให้ฉันสามารถดำเนินการได้ ฉันทราบดีว่าUITextViewสามารถตรวจจับการแตะ URL และโทรกลับผู้รับมอบสิทธิ์ของฉันได้ แต่นี่ไม่ใช่ URL สำหรับฉันแล้วดูเหมือนว่าด้วย iOS 7 และพลังของ TextKit ตอนนี้น่าจะเป็นไปได้ แต่ฉันไม่พบตัวอย่างใด ๆ และฉันไม่แน่ใจว่าจะเริ่มจากตรงไหน ฉันเข้าใจว่าตอนนี้คุณสามารถสร้างแอตทริบิวต์ที่กำหนดเองในสตริงได้แล้ว (แม้ว่าฉันจะยังไม่ได้ทำก็ตาม) และบางทีสิ่งเหล่านี้อาจเป็นประโยชน์ในการตรวจจับว่ามีการแตะคำวิเศษหรือไม่? ไม่ว่าในกรณีใดฉันยังไม่ทราบวิธีสกัดกั้นการแตะและตรวจจับคำที่เกิดจากการแตะ โปรดทราบว่าไม่จำเป็นต้องใช้ความเข้ากันได้กับ iOS 6

5
iOS 7 TextKit - วิธีแทรกรูปภาพในบรรทัดพร้อมข้อความ?
ฉันพยายามรับเอฟเฟกต์ต่อไปนี้โดยใช้ UITextView: โดยทั่วไปฉันต้องการแทรกรูปภาพระหว่างข้อความ รูปภาพสามารถใช้พื้นที่ได้เพียง 1 แถวจึงไม่จำเป็นต้องห่อ ฉันลองเพิ่ม UIView ในมุมมองย่อย: UIView *pictureView = [[UIView alloc] initWithFrame:CGRectMake(0, 0, 25, 25)]; [pictureView setBackgroundColor:[UIColor redColor]]; [self.textView addSubview:pictureView]; แต่ดูเหมือนว่าจะลอยอยู่เหนือข้อความและครอบคลุม ฉันได้อ่านเกี่ยวกับเส้นทางการยกเว้นซึ่งดูเหมือนจะเป็นวิธีหนึ่งในการนำไปใช้ อย่างไรก็ตามฉันไม่ต้องการวางตำแหน่งรูปภาพอย่างแน่นอน แต่ควรไหลไปกับข้อความ (คล้ายกับวิธีการ<span>ทำงานใน HTML)
109 ios  ios7  textkit 
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.